ROXAS CITY, Capiz — Fifteen residents of Barangay Cogon were arrested Tuesday, March 31, by joint forces from the Roxas City Police Station and Task Force Bantay Dagat during an operation in Barangay Olotayan.
The group faces charges under City Ordinance No. 16-2023, specifically Section 27, which bans commercial fishing in city waters, and Section 73, which covers unauthorized fishery activities.
Authorities recovered a fishing boat valued at PHP 600,000, a Mitsubishi Fuso 6D14 engine worth PHP 100,000, fishing gear and nets valued at PHP 400,000, and roughly 1,000 kilograms of assorted fish worth PHP 150,000.
The suspects were turned over to the Roxas City Fisheries and Agriculture Office for proper disposition and the filing of appropriate charges.
